Being a part of the entertainment industry can sound like an exciting adventure - but how well are you prepared for this journey?

To be one of the best in the entertainment sector, you need to have what it takes to outshine your competitors and put your name out there. And one of the best ways to do that is to have several skills within your work arsenal.

According to a report by the CII-BCG, it was found that variables such as changing the nature of new business models, consumer demands, and digital distributions have led to many expectations and a need to introduce an entirely new workforce. The report also includes that, given the industry's growth rate, the demand for talented and skilled professionals will definitely outpace the supply.

The media industry is an umbrella sector for various exciting sub-sector fields like film, music, publishing, television, and many more. What is even more exciting is that these fields will continue to grow over the years - consequently leading to increased creative working opportunities.

This also creates an exciting learning experience where you can learn so many new things and also be able to share your multifaceted skills with the world. It also gives you a chance to showcase your abilities, thoughts, ideals, and strong beliefs that you value to the world. Additionally, as the entertainment industry is highly dependent on technology, it also gives you increased options to create projects based on your ideal needs, as you will have the perfect tools to turn your dreams into a reality.

In fact, many professionals have already ensured a prosperous future by harnessing their many skill sets. For example, Eddie Vuittonet has taken on a number of roles in his professional career. He is known for being a renowned entrepreneur, musician, digital marketer, graphic artist, author, former judge, and martial artist who served as the founder of many establishments - a few examples being, Muryo Waza Martial Arts Academy, the Comic Syndrome, the Kosmic Kraze, Creative Audio Concepts, Eddie Vuittonet Private Investigator, Early Bird Home Nursing, Inc., Los Vecinos Adult Day Care, Inc., Aunt and Uncles Fast Foods, ISOG. Inc., Vuittonet Feed & Seed, Custom Repair and Restorations, Madre Seca Films, etc.

In 1971, Vuittonet opened his very first martial arts school in Texas and then became the founder and teacher of self-defense techniques from different martial arts styles in California that he names Muryo Waza. He was also interested in writing and would create social program projects, including co-authoring the Four Miler Program/Manual and the Graffiti Prevention Program for the Department of Housing and Community Development.

In 1997, Vuittonet also got the chance to become an international bounty hunter in Mexico while also being a deputy constable and running his and Muryo Waza, Martial Arts school and Maverick Collections.

In 1985, he also became a United States Border Patrol Agent.

He is currently involved in writing books, publishing comic books and the music industry.

The cover studio band "Eddie Vuittonet and the Time Travelers" have marketed more than 17 music albums, and over 200 singles and have been recording constantly ever since they entered the industry.
